Many elements have non-intergral atomic masses because (1)the constituents neutrons, protons, and electrons, commbine to give fractional masses (2) they have isotopes (3) their isotopes have nonintergal masses (4) their isotopes have different massesA. `(i),(ii),(iii),(iv)`B. `(ii),(iii),(iv)`C. `(ii),(iv)`D. `(iii),(iv)` |
Answer» Correct Answer - B Many element occur in nature as mixtures of isotopes. The atomic mass (weight) of such an element is the weighted average of the masses of its isotopes. Thus, atmoic masses are fractional numbers, not integers. For example, `{:(Isot ope,%Abundance,Mass(am u),,),(._(12)^24Mg,78.99,23.98504,,),(._(12)^25Mg,10.00,24.98584,,),(._(12)^(26)Mg,11.01,25.98259,,):}` Atomic mass (weight) `=(0.7899)(23.98504u)+(0.1000)(24.98584) +(0.1101) (25.98259u)` `=18.946u+2.4986u+ 2.860u` `= 24.30u` (to four significant figures) |
